Gas Prices Soar: West Virginia Residents Feel the Pinch
Gas prices in the U.S. have reached their highest point since 2022, averaging over four dollars a gallon, with West Virginia slightly below this mark. Prices have surged by 35% in the last month, causing financial strain for residents, particularly truck drivers. Governor Patrick Morrisey is promoting West Virginia as a budget-friendly travel destination, potentially attracting more visitors seeking cost-effective fuel options.
